GIT | نظام التحكم بالاصدارات
Description
هذا الكورس المميز يقدم دليلاً شاملاً لفهم واستخدام نظام التحكم بالإصدارات Git، الذي يُعد أداة حيوية في عالم تطوير البرمجيات. سواء كنت مبرمجاً مبتدئاً أو محترفاً، سيساعدك هذا الكورس على إتقان أساسيات Git وكيفية تطبيقها في مشاريعك اليومية. سنبدأ من الصفر، مع شرح مفاهيم التحكم بالإصدارات وأهميتها في تتبع التغييرات في الكود المصدري، مما يضمن التعاون الفعال بين الفرق وتجنب الأخطاء.
يتعمق الكورس في الجوانب العملية، حيث سنغطي سير العمل الأساسي في Git، بما في ذلك كيفية تهيئة المستودع، وإضافة الملفات، وتسجيل التغييرات عبر الـ commits. ستتعلم كيفية استخدام أوامر Git الأساسية لإدارة مشاريعك بكل كفاءة. كما سننتقل إلى العمل مع المستودعات البعيدة مثل GitHub، لتمكينك من مشاركة الكود والعمل مع الآخرين بسلاسة.
بالإضافة إلى ذلك، سيناقش الكورس المواضيع المتقدمة مثل التعامل مع الفروع ودمجها، مما يسمح لك بتطوير ميزات متعددة في وقت واحد دون تعطيل الخط الرئيسي للمشروع. وأخيراً، سنغطي أساسيات طلبات السحب (Pull Requests) على GitHub، والتي تُستخدم لمراجعة الكود ودمجه بطريقة منظمة. بنهاية هذا الكورس، ستكون قادراً على استخدام Git و GitHub بثقة في بيئات التطوير الحقيقية.
أهم النقاط التي يتناولها هذا الكورس:
- مقدمة عن التحكم بالإصدارات وأهمية Git في إدارة المشاريع البرمجية.
- شرح سير العمل الأساسي في Git، بما في إضافة الملفات وتسجيل التغييرات.
- التعرف على المستودعات البعيدة وكيفية ربطها بالمستودع المحلي باستخدام GitHub.
- التعامل مع المستودعات البعيدة عبر سحب ودفع التغييرات لمزامنة العمل.
- إنشاء الفروع ودمجها لإدارة تطور المشروع وتجنب التعارضات.
- أساسيات طلبات السحب لتعزيز التعاون ومراجعة الكود في الفرق.
يتعمق الكورس في الجوانب العملية، حيث سنغطي سير العمل الأساسي في Git، بما في ذلك كيفية تهيئة المستودع، وإضافة الملفات، وتسجيل التغييرات عبر الـ commits. ستتعلم كيفية استخدام أوامر Git الأساسية لإدارة مشاريعك بكل كفاءة. كما سننتقل إلى العمل مع المستودعات البعيدة مثل GitHub، لتمكينك من مشاركة الكود والعمل مع الآخرين بسلاسة.
بالإضافة إلى ذلك، سيناقش الكورس المواضيع المتقدمة مثل التعامل مع الفروع ودمجها، مما يسمح لك بتطوير ميزات متعددة في وقت واحد دون تعطيل الخط الرئيسي للمشروع. وأخيراً، سنغطي أساسيات طلبات السحب (Pull Requests) على GitHub، والتي تُستخدم لمراجعة الكود ودمجه بطريقة منظمة. بنهاية هذا الكورس، ستكون قادراً على استخدام Git و GitHub بثقة في بيئات التطوير الحقيقية.
أهم النقاط التي يتناولها هذا الكورس:
- مقدمة عن التحكم بالإصدارات وأهمية Git في إدارة المشاريع البرمجية.
- شرح سير العمل الأساسي في Git، بما في إضافة الملفات وتسجيل التغييرات.
- التعرف على المستودعات البعيدة وكيفية ربطها بالمستودع المحلي باستخدام GitHub.
- التعامل مع المستودعات البعيدة عبر سحب ودفع التغييرات لمزامنة العمل.
- إنشاء الفروع ودمجها لإدارة تطور المشروع وتجنب التعارضات.
- أساسيات طلبات السحب لتعزيز التعاون ومراجعة الكود في الفرق.
0
7
03:37:33
2021-07-04
0
0
7/0 100/0
المقدمة وأساسيات جيت
المستودعات البعيدة
الفروع وطلبات السحب